Industrial environments are complex and power systems are subject to high and low temperatures, vibration, noise, electromagnetic interference and other factors. Eaton Electronics provides power inductors, over-current and over-voltage circuit protection, sensors, capacitors and other electronic components suitable for industrial environments. They have good tolerance of voltage, current, power, frequency, temperature and other parameters, with a variety of choices, stable and reliable.

 

 Eaton offers shielded, semi-shielded, and unibody inductors with high current, low EMI characteristics over a wide operating temperature range, as well as other devices such as common-mode noise filtering and EMI noise reduction.

 

Circuit protection products can protect against high currents and transient voltages under the operation of industrial equipment, avoiding possible failures such as overloads, overvoltages and short circuits.

 

● Temperature and current sensors can provide accurate data for battery management systems to help them fulfil functions such as energy monitoring and management, power protection and control, and effectively improve equipment performance and reliability.

Overcurrent protection for high-current power cords: 2822HC fast-acting fuses

图片3.png


● 40 A to 125 A ultra-high current carrying capacity

● High-current chip fuses with high breaking capacity

● 7.7 x 6.0 x 4.3 mm surface mount package

● Rated voltage up to 80 Vdc

● Monolithic fuse solution for high-current applications
